Silkworm (Bombyx mori) is model organism belonging to the second largest order Lepidoptera, Saturniidae. Silkworm has played an important role as an important economic insects in the development of silk industry, food, medicine and other fields, and silkworm is one of the classic biological in genetic studies. To investigate wether the transgenic feed affect economic traits and genetic traits of silkworm, According to glyphosate-resistant gene DNA sequence logged in GenBank, transgenic soybean primers were designed to identify qualitatively silkworm feed as containing glyphosate-resistant gene transgenic feed.Since the first genetically modified crop came into being in the world, the genetically modified crops as a cluster of highest economic return crop have been widely spread in an incomparable speed throughout the globe. A pairs of primers were designed according to entire exogenous DNA sequence of GM soybean from GenBank and used to detect transgenic silkworm feeds by qualitative test. Results showed that the feed is containing Roundup Ready gene.Statistics and the single factor of variance were analyzed for economic traits of continuous three generation silkworm fed with transgenic and non-transgenic feed, such as instar duration, whole cocoon weight, cocoon shell weight, cocoon shell ratio,pupae weight, setae dispersion rate,mortality and moltweight. At the same time the expression of exogenous genes were detected by PCR in silkworm tissues after feeding transgenic feed. The results showed that transgenic feed have no significant impact on growth and development of silkworm,and there were no pollution of exogenous gene in silkworm DNA.AFLP technology has the advantages,high accuracy, good sensitivity, good repeatability, high polymorphism, and in a short time can detect the nuances of DNA samples. Using this technique,silkworm genome were analyzed on silkworm of three generations fed non-transgenic and transgenic feed. The results showed that no difference were observed from the silver staining figure of silkworm genome of each generation using between non-transgenic feed and transgenic modified feed.So that transgenic feed is safe for feeding silkworm, but evaluation of transgenic feed for safety of silkworm rearing is a long process needed further in depth.
